I whipped up the gingerbread glazed, poured it over the nuts, spread them in a baking sheet and tossed them in the oven for 10 minutes. This literally took 15 minutes from start to finish and the only hard part was controlling myself while the scent of gingerbread taunted me from the oven.
Actually, these were almost just gingerbread glazed nuts, because they tasted pretty good just mixed with the glaze. But after they came out the oven and I tasted one, I was so glad I decided to suffer through those 10 minutes. The nuts got a little extra crunch and the flavours were richer after roasting- especially the pecans. And it all got even better after cooling.
These gingerbread glazed roasted nuts are the perfect blend of the tartness of molasses, sweetness of maple syrup and the spiciness of ginger. It may be time for another mouth-gasm.

- 1½ cups almonds
- 1½ cupa pecans
- 1 tsp coconut oil
- 2 tbsp maple syrup
- 2-3 tbsp molasses
- ½ tsp ground cinnamon
- 2 tsp ginger
- Preheat oven to 350F.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and set aside
- Add the nuts to a bowl and set aside
- In a small sauce pan, heat coconut oil, maple syrup, molasses and spices over low heat, until well combined
- Pour the glaze over the nuts and mix until evenly coated
- Spread the glazed nuts onto the lined baking sheet and bake for 10 minutes
- Remove from the oven and form or separate clusters as desired. Nuts will stick together when cooled
- Allow to cool completely before storing in an airtight containter
